Step by Step
1
Trim limeade paper to measure 10cm by 14.5cm. Ink the edges and affix to the card. Trim cupcake paper to measure 10cm by 5cm. Ink the edges and glue at the bottom of the card.
2
Apply green organza and pink spotty ribbon across the card, attaching on the reverse of the card. Tie a knot of spotty ribbon around the horizontal strand.
3
Use the Quickutz tree die to cut out the tree sections in two green shades. Use a scrap of brown card to cut the tree trunk.
4
Assemble the parts of the tree to the right hand side of the card. (Use alternating colours of green for the tree).
5
Apply the word ‘Noel’ using alphabet stickers and gemstones as an accent.
